Questions & Answers
Q: How can entrepreneurs improve their hiring process?
Gary advises entrepreneurs to hire people who are good at what they are not and to evaluate their performance to ensure they are doing well.
Q: How can entrepreneurs manage employees who are not performing at the expected level?
Gary suggests creating a culture where entitlement and apathy are not tolerated and to not be afraid to fire underperforming employees.
Q: How should entrepreneurs build their personal brand?
Gary recommends blending personal and business brands and focusing on creating valuable content that will build trust and authority with the audience.
Q: How can entrepreneurs build and maintain a positive company culture?
Gary believes that the best way to teach culture is through firing employees who are not aligned with the company culture and values.
Q: What are some effective marketing strategies for entrepreneurs?
Gary suggests utilizing Facebook ads to target specific local areas and to create content that educates and helps potential customers, rather than focusing on direct sales tactics.
